A once-in-a-lifetime experience featuring first-ever performances of tracks from All Over the Place, a retelling of the story of KSI, past, present and future with special guests and key characters throughout his journey and more. Let KSI take you on an adventure through his world. Get ready for thrills, laughs and lots of surprises alongside huge production value, highly stylised artistic direction, flawless tunes, costume changes, a boxing match and choreography by industry leaders Black Skull Creative.

Liz Clare is an award winning Multi-Camera Director, working across a wide range of genres, including live events, live music, concert films, theatre capture, award ceremonies, large scale entertainment, comedy and chat show formats. She has delivered shows for some of the most successful international producers, including MTV Networks, Disney+, ITV Studios, BBC Studios, Done and Dusted, Fulwell 73, Mercury Studios, Amazon Prime, BAFTA and BRITS TV. As a specialist in live broadcasting, Liz has developed strong and trusting relationships with creative teams, artists, producers and clients, working on projects from concept through to delivery. Her extensive knowledge of filming techniques, exceptional creativity and attention to detail, brings a mastery to the storytelling. She has directed some of the most iconic TV moments of recent years, including The MTV Video Music Awards, An Audience With Adele, The Funeral of HM The Queen, The Brit Awards, Dua Lipa's Studio 2054, The BAFTA Film Awards, The Voice UK, Britain's Got Talent and the multi-award winning Passchendaele 100 for the BBC.
